Key Takeaways

  • The dealer must mark all parts of a Report of Sale–Used Vehicle (REG 51) form “void” when the REG 51 was completed in error and the sale was not consummated.
  • Complete a Statement of Facts (REG 256) (PDF) form explaining the error and stating that the vehicle did not leave the dealer’s possession and was not operated….
  • Do not mark a REG 51 “void” if the buyer took possession and subsequently returned the vehicle to the dealer (See “Rollbacks”, Chapter 11, Transfers).
  • The dealer must retain all copies of a voided report of sale and the REG 256, with the book copy, at the dealer’s primary business location so it is available….
